Remeber that WP8 is the same OS as Windows 8, where WP7 was not an OS.
I think there may be issues when they issue updates, so testing Win 7 may increase the time it takes to ship updates.
Loading User Information from Channel 9
Something went wrong getting user information from Channel 9
Loading User Information from MSDN
Something went wrong getting user information from MSDN
Loading Visual Studio Achievements
Something went wrong getting the Visual Studio Achievements
Remeber that WP8 is the same OS as Windows 8, where WP7 was not an OS.
I think there may be issues when they issue updates, so testing Win 7 may increase the time it takes to ship updates.